By abc Sun May 08, 2016 11:18 am
Real distorted, but I had the record gain all the way down.
User avatar
By Lampdog Mon May 09, 2016 6:38 am
Source volume too high?? No matter record gain volume, if source is too high distortion can still happen.

Turn all volumes to 50% and then start there. Crank up till you hear distortion, stop and crank down just a little.
